From d7445676e86900f8dc363825033ff62416c216e0 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Arnd Bergmann Date: Fri, 1 Apr 2022 14:35:42 +0200 Subject: ARM: versatile: move integrator/realview/vexpress to versatile These are all fairly small platforms by now, and they are closely related. Just move them all into a single directory.
